  1. Perform diagnostic imaging procedures, including x-rays, MRIs, and CT scans, in a safe and efficient manner.
  2. Maintain a high level of technical proficiency and accuracy in following established protocols and procedures.
  3. Ensure patient safety and comfort during procedures by practicing proper radiation safety measures and providing clear instructions and support.
  4. Collaborate with physicians and other healthcare professionals to provide accurate and timely imaging results for patient diagnosis and treatment.
  5. Maintain and operate imaging equipment, including troubleshooting and reporting any malfunctions.
  6. Adhere to all organizational and regulatory standards, policies, and procedures to ensure quality and safety in patient care.
  7. Maintain patient records and documentation according to established guidelines.
  8. Continuously seek opportunities for professional development and stay current with advancements in radiology technology and techniques.
  9. Act as a patient advocate by providing compassionate care and addressing any concerns or questions.
  10. Contribute to a positive and collaborative team environment by communicating effectively and working cooperatively with colleagues and other departments.
  11. Participate in quality improvement initiatives and assist with maintaining accreditation and compliance standards.
  12. Demonstrate a commitment to Atrium Health's mission and values in all aspects of the job.

Compensation

According to JobzMall, the average salary range for a Radiologic Technologist in Rome, GA, USA is $41,000-$63,000 per year. However, this can vary depending on factors such as experience, certification, and employer. Additionally, location can also play a role in salary differences for this profession.

About Atrium Health

Atrium Health, formerly Carolinas HealthCare System, is a not for profit hospital network which operates hospitals, freestanding emergency departments, urgent care centers, and medical practices in the American states of North Carolina, South Carolina and Georgia.
